2-[N-(2-hydroxyethyl)-3-methylanilino]ethanol
Also Known As: M-TOLYLDIETHANOLAMINE, 2,2'-(m-Tolylazanediyl)diethanol, m-Tolydiethanolamine, MTDEA, Diethanol-m-toluidine

| Molecular Formula | C11H17NO2 |
| Molecular Weight | 195.12593 g/mol |
| XLogP | 1.4 |
| Topological Polar Surface Area (TPSA) | 43.7 Ų |
| Hydrogen Bond Donors | 2 |
| Hydrogen Bond Acceptors | 3 |
| Rotatable Bonds | 5 |
| Exact Mass | 195.12593 Da |
| Heavy Atoms | 14 |
| Complexity | 146.0 |
| SMILES | CC1=CC(=CC=C1)N(CCO)CCO |
| InChIKey | VMNDRLYLEVCGAG-UHFFFAOYSA-N |
Applications: 2,2'-((3-Methylphenyl)imino)bisethanol is used in dye and pigment synthesis and coloration chemistry, as well as polymer chemistry and functional materials synthesis. It commonly serves as a versatile building block for organic synthesis. The XLogP value of 1.4 suggests moderate lipophilicity, balancing water solubility and membrane permeability for 2,2'-((3-Methylphenyl)imino)bisethanol. With a topological polar surface area (TPSA) of 43.7 Ų, 2,2'-((3-Methylphenyl)imino)bisethanol ex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, 2,2'-((3-Methylphenyl)imino)bisethanol has 2 hydrogen bond donor(s) and 3 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
